You voided your warranty. I hope you have insurance... Best bet is to try an Apple Store and hope they are busy... Sometimes you get lucky and they'll replace it without looking.
Keep in mind you have one shot at it though. If the rep deems it out of warranty then you SOL and have to pay out a large sum of money as they keep track of it in their computers. So going to another rep on another day they will see you already came in, and was marked as water damages. Then you will fall under THIS
An iPhone that is ineligible for warranty service may be eligible for Out-of-Warranty (OOW) Service. For example, an iPhone that has failed due to damage or liquid damage is ineligible for warranty service but eligible for OOW service. However, certain damage is ineligible for OOW service, including catastrophic damage, such as the device separating into multiple pieces, and inoperability caused by unauthorized modifications. Please see Apple's Repair Terms And Conditions for further details. Refer to this article to check if the Liquid Contact indicator on your product has been triggered.
- Out-of-Warranty Service
If you own an iPhone that is ineligible for warranty service but is eligible for Out-of-Warranty (OOW) Service, Apple will service your iPhone for the Out-of-Warranty Service fee listed below.
iPhone 4 Out-of-Warranty Service 16GB & 32GB $199 iPhone 3GS Out-of-Warranty Service 8GB, 16GB & 32GB $199 iPhone 3G Out-of-Warranty Service 8GB & 16GB $199 Original iPhone Out-of-Warranty Service 4GB, 8GB & 16GB $199 A $6.95 shipping fee will be added if you arrange service online or by calling Apple Technical Support. All fees are in U.S. dollars and are subject to local tax.
